IN HER VOICES piece, columnist Gwen Loughman explores the “modern renaissance” of tattoos and her own decision to get one.
Loughman describes the months of deliberation behind choosing her permanent design: “I spent several months giving careful consideration to what I was about to do. My research bordered on near obsessive levels of intensity.”
Just as well, as according to Earthweb.com, approximately 78% of people with body art regret at least one of their designs.
“With that as my North Star, I told myself I was making the right call by overthinking it to death,” she writes.
While society has grown more accepting of tattoos (and even more eager to get them), Loughman says that certain professions still quietly discourage body art, an idea she describes as rooted in “a stuffy conservatism”.
